Transaction 87ad0edbbfd071e3333551db1a10fa1074c952413520204564b6bc572708a371
1 Input
1 Output
-
87ad0edbbfd071e3333551db1a10fa1074c952413520204564b6bc572708a371:0
- value
- 26442620
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 245eba55291daf153a6db8d83a21560ea852bd54 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14KJoiMyEaqk5MJboMjLG9tLizzgRvZdcz